Research Abstract

When the muscle cell membrane was subjected to the damage, the membrane was immediately repaired by the action of "membrane repairing molecules". Osteoclasts are formed by fusion of mononuclear osteoclast precursors, and this process is postulated to be guarranteed by the action of "membrane reparing mechanisms". The purpose of this research is to identify MG53 or its analogue and involvement of membrane repairing mechanism" during the process of osteoclast differentiation. Unstimulated osteoclast precursors expressed MG53. However, its expression was dramatically suppressed after being stimulated to form osteoclasts. Our data suggested that the "membrane repairing molecule" could act as the negative regulator for osteoclast differentiation.
